The following information is given for mercury at 1 atm: AHvap (356.60°C) = 295.6 J/g AHfus (-38.90°C) = 11.60 J/g T, 356.60°C Tm =-38.90°C Specific heat gas = 0.1040 J/g °C Specific heat liquid = 0.1390 J/g °C A 40.60 g sample of liquid mercury is initially at 199.70°C. If the sample is heated at constant pressure (P = 1 atm), kJ of energy are needed to raise he temperature of the sample to 375.00°C.
